Xon/Xoff Handshaking (I.D. #C5)
Bar codes for setting this parameter are on page 50.
This parameter is used for software data-flow control. The host can send
the Xon character (ASCII 11h) to allow transmission and send the Xoff
character (ASCII 13h) to stop transmission.
